An experimental design in which the independent variable is made to vary across two or more groups of subjects: Group of answer
loris [4]

Answer:

1. between-subjects

Explanation:

Between-subjects experiment: In psychological or scientific research, the term between-subjects experiment is one of the types of experimental design whereby the subjects or participants of an experiment or research are being assigned under different conditions and therefore each subject or participant will experience only one experimental condition.

The between-subject design is being widely used in the field of social science.
